Post by: Hardy Heinlin on Tue, 22 Sep 2015 09:11
Good morning,

when you start with "AerowinxStart.jar", are you sure you really start with "AerowinxStart.jar", not with "Aerowinx.jar"?

I think some start parameters for the Java VM might be missing. These are included in "AerowinxStart.jar" and "AerowinxNetStart.jar" -- but not in "Aerowinx.jar".

Do you use a shortcut (do you click on a shortcut icon)? If so, are you sure it's linked with "AerowinxStart.jar"?

By the way ...

QuoteFyi  in order to use my full cockpit with 4 screens I open Aerowinx 3 times
one for each sight ( Instruments/Overhead/Pedestal) which worked perfectly in the past

You can edit AerowinxNetStart.ini so that it loads 4 PSX instances instead of 2. Just edit it with a text editor and add two more pref file names, e.g.:

NetStartDemoLeft.pref
NetStartDemoLeft.pref
NetStartDemoLeft.pref
NetStartDemoRight.pref
